So I just purchased a preowned 2007 GL450 with 88000 miles. The check engine light comes on and I take it to the dealer. After having it about a day, they find that it needs a new charcoal canister and shut off valve ($900 repair) (emissions). It ran fine and no light and started perfectly (before taking it in, it would not start half of the time). I get 1 mile from home and check engine light comes back on! I load my code reader and am getting a P0455. And yes, the car seems to have a fairly new gas cap and it was tightened to 4 clicks.
Any ideas would be appreciated.
